Skip to main content


Linear Algebra Foundations to Frontiers - Programming for Correctness Online Course Launches Second Offering

05/15/2018 - The only effective way to raise the confidence level of a program significantly is to give a convincing proof of its correctness. But one should not first make the program and then prove its correctness, because then the requirement of providing the proof would only increase the poor programmer’s burden. On the contrary: the programmer should let correctness proof and program grow hand-in-hand. - “The Humble Programmer,” Edsger W. Dijkstra (1972)

Linear Algebra - Foundations To Frontiers Kicks off Its Seventh Run

01/22/2018 - On January 23, 2018, UTCS faculty (and spouses) Robert van de Geijn and Maggie Myers will kick off the seventh run of their 16 week MOOCs (Massively Open Online Course) on linear algebra from a computer science perspective called Linear Algebra - Foundations to Frontiers (LAFF). The course is self-paced with a suggested calendar but everything is due by the close of the course on May 31.

Linear Algebra - Foundations To Frontiers Kicks off Its Fifth Run

UT Computer Science plus edX

12/12/2016 - On January 25, 2017, UTCS faculty (and spouses) Robert van de Geijn and Maggie Myers will kick off the fifth run of their 16 week MOOCs (Massively Open Online Course) on linear algebra from a computer science perspective called Linear Algebra - Foundations to Frontiers (LAFF) Robert and Maggie have enhanced the course by working with MathWorks to enable participants to use Matlab freely during the course.

Linear Algebra - Foundations To Frontiers Kicks off Its Second Year

12/09/2014 - On January 28, 2015 UTCS faculty (and by the way spouses) Robert van de Geijn and Maggie Myers will kick off the second year of their 16 week MOOCs (massively open online course) on linear algebra from a computer science perspective called Linear Algebra - Foundations to Frontiers. Robert and Maggie have enhanced the course by working with MathWorks to enable participants to use Matlab freely during the course.